Whenever there is a coaching change, transfers follow, and that is even more true in the NIL/transfer portal era.

Here is how the multiple transfers from Tulane who went to FBS schools are faring at their new schools, including a few who left two years ago.

Chris Brazzell: 10 catches for 140 yards and a TD at Tennessee

Comment: He was gone even if Fritz had stayed. As talented as the loaded Vols are, I still thought his numbers would be even better.

Kentrell Webb: 13 tackles for Houston.

Comment: Webb had a lot of promise, but if you had told me he would have the most tackles this season of any of the transfers, I would have doubted you.

Keith Cooper: 10 tackles, 4 for loss, 2 sacks for Houston

Comment: He's just a really good player.

DJ Douglas: 10 tackles for Florida

Comment: I'm guessing he got a good NIL deal. Otherwise, he can't be happier there as the Billy Napier era turns into a car crash.

Devean Deal: 8 tackles, 2.5 for loss. 0.5 sacks for TCU

Comment: TCU blew an 11-point fourth-quarter lead and lost to UCF 35-34 Saturday. Deal appears to be playing pretty well.

Jadon Canady: 9 tackles, 2 passes defensed at Ole Miss

Comment: When I wrote he was a big loss before 2023, Wes Fritz texted me that he would be out for the year with the knee injury he sustained against Memphis in 2022. He was almost right. Canady had two tackles last year but is healthy this season.

Hunter Summers: 4 catches for 50 yards at Arkansas State

Comment: Summers was not ready to play last year but I liked his potential.

Iverson Celestine: 2 carries, 5 yards; 2 catches, 18 yards at South Alabama

Comment: he was buried on the depth chart at Tulane and would not have gotten on the field this year

Terez Traynor: 1 catch for 12 yards at Charlotte

Comment: We barely knew him after the Idaho's transfer's stop-over in the spring. Tulane will face him on Halloween.

Jared Small: no stats at Arizona

Comment: Not sure how he won an appeal for an eighth year of eligiblity, but he has yet to play for the Wildcats.

Other transfers with no stats:

Cam Carroll in his second and final year at Florida. He suffered a knee injury in the preseason last year.

Maxie Baudoin, who was deep down on the depth chart, is a reserve DT at UL-Lafayette but has not played yet.

UCF spring stop-over Jaylon Griffin has zero catches for Texas State.

Jai Eugene, who was not happy about being behind Rishi Rattan, has not played for Western Kentucky.

Corey Platt tore his Achilles again at Houston.
